You're Going To Have To Know Some Things

Rating: 5.0


you're going to have to know some things

they all forgot to tell you

or maybe they didn't know themselves;

then how will you know the difference?

following the moss on the northern sides of trees

was that it

the native american signs of spring

the ruby red ring around the moon

is it noon yet in China

opals have fallen out of the skies

some people tell lies

always carry a compass.

be on the lookout for wild mushrooms.

hide in the tall grasses
with the scent of wild onions

and dream the lion's dream.

carry the storybook somehow

the one with strawberries and cream.

when you get hungry,

look at the lllustration.

mary angela douglas 18 November 2019
